Nemertelline is a neurotoxic tetra-pyridine compound originally found in the marine ribbon worm Amphiporus angulatus. [1] These worms produce a variety of toxins which are used both in hunting their prey and in defending themselves from predators. [2] Interest in potential application of this compound as an antifouling agent for boats and other marine installations has led to attempts to produce it synthetically by convenient routes. [3] Its toxicity is similar to nicotine in crustaceans but has no mammalian toxicity. It is similar to nicotelline in structure. [4]
